Google Adds Docs Preview To Gmail
The ability to watch YouTube videos or view Picasa Web albums directly within Gmail has become one of my favorite features. No more clicking on a link and being taken to an external site. Everything can be viewed from the comfort of my inbox, where I like to hang out. I do the bulk of my writing within Google Docs. I often share Docs with colleagues via the tools already available in Docs, and they share with me, too. With the new Google Docs Preview Lab enabled, Gmail users will be able to see, well, a preview of any attached Docs, Spreadsheets or Presentations. Simply click on the "show preview" link and the document's contents will be displayed right there.
